According to the TCAN4550 datasheet "SLLSF91 - DECEMBER 2018" the tcan4x5x has
the same bittiming constants as a m_can revision 3.2.x/3.3.0.

The tcan4x5x chip I'm using identifies itself as m_can revision 3.2.1, so
remove the tcan4x5x specific bittiming values and rely on the values in the
m_can driver, which are selected according to core revision.
